There are two ways to install Google Chrome on Ubuntu 18.04 (Bionic Beaver).
- Installing Google Chrome with the graphical interface
- Installing Google Chrome using the terminal
You can use the following commands to install Google Chrome using Terminal on Ubuntu 18.04.
-
a) 64 Bit: wget https://dl.google.com/linux/direct/google-chrome-stable_current_amd64.deb
b) 32 Bit: wget https://dl.google.com/linux/direct/google-chrome-stable_current_i386.deb
-
sudo dpkg –i google-chrome-stable_current_amd64.deb
-
sudo apt-get install –f
